North Country Debate Downsized Amid Labor ProtestsBy Josh Rogers on Tuesday, May 7, 2002.Yesterday's gubernatorial forum at the Mount Washington hotel did not go off according to plan?. Three candidates ? republicans Craig Benson and Bruce Keough, and Libertarian John Babiarz participated; while four others, Democrats Jim Normand, Beverly Hollingworth, Mark Fernald, and Republican Gordon Humphrey, refused to cross an information picket set up to protest hotel labor policy.
